WebA second popular approach uses PCR to amplify the region of interest from the plasmid. The resulting PCR product is then cloned into the desired vector. TA cloning or blunt-end cloning methods can be used as described in the PCR cloning section, but neither approach maintains directionality of the insert. WebGene cloning is also used for specific purposes in the medical field such as insulin production. Diabetic people need insulin shots and the medicine they need is made by gene cloning. The process is identical to normal gene cloning but the desired gene is the one linked to insulin production in the human body. This gene is cloned and produces ... WebAll cloning vectors need sites that will allow the insertion of foreign DNA into it. Most commonly, this involves the use of restriction enzyme recognition sites. Ideally, the enzyme should have 1 1 1 1 , or a maximum of 2 2 2 2 recognition sites, preferably within the selectable marker sequences (as seen in the image below).
